Parabola GNU/Linux basically is Arch without the proprietary software. Since
you wrote that you had a good experience with Arch, you should be at home.
Trisquel is based on Ubuntu: fixed instead of rolling release, A

There are imperfect solutions to this. One common solution is to add PPAs to
get the packages you want. Another thing some people do, including myself,
is to install the GNU Guix package manager and install apps with that. GNU
Guix is rolling release, so everything is up to date.
